Power to Regulate

Would you like to gain positive control over two vital aspects of life: health and relationships?  Your body performance and interpersonal connections weigh heavily on the proper supervision of a tiny, yet powerful orifice.  If you want these areas to improve, you must regulate what passes through your mouth.

Whoso keepeth his mouth and his tongue
keepeth his soul from troubles.
– Proverbs 21:23

Your mouth, specifically your tongue, will demand its own pleasure if let unbridled.  It is so powerful that it can consume to the detriment of your body.  Poor input management can lead to stress and disease.  For optimal physical health, input regulation is critical.  Your Heavenly Father provides wisdom on what to ingest and supernatural strength for the discipline regulation requires.

However, output governance of your mouth is vital to your spiritual wellness and thriving relationships.  What it transmits has the power to build up and edify or to tear down and destroy. Your mouth can also speak through tweets, posts, comments and other social media platforms.  The more you regulate what your mouth says, the more control you gain over your life.

For those who want to love life and see good days should keep their tongue from evil speaking and their lips from speaking lies.
– 1 Peter 3:10 Common English Bible

Whatever happened to the teaching…If you can’t say something nice, don’t say anything at all?  Even the Word of God advises…

Understand this, my beloved brothers and sisters.
Let everyone be quick to hear [be a careful, thoughtful listener],
slow to speak [a speaker of carefully chosen words and],
slow to anger [patient, reflective, forgiving];
– James 1:19 Amplified Bible

Your joy, peace, well-being and power are directly connected to the content in your mouth.  If you are going to open it, do your best to regulate it.

Abuse of Power

Have you ever been bullied by a person who claims to be a Christian?

They are initially perceived as kind, but over time and often behind closed doors, a monster emerges.  Either you had or currently have a close relationship with this person through work, family or personal connection.  They distort God’s Word to impose a reckless power and ultimately, try to control you.  After being in their presence, you feel completely drained and disconnected from the awesome love of Christ.

Maybe you can relate to one of these situations:

Your mistakes and flaws are constantly pointed out. Since they have spent a considerable amount of time with you, they know you more intimately than others.  They act as if they are an appointed representative sent by God to judge you…scrutinize you…admonish you…over and over again.  Their vitriol never lets up.  However, no provision is made on their behalf to actually help you grow.  They consistently put you down to lift themselves up.  Their jealousy, bitterness and hypocrisy manifests over time and your “bad” behavior is always to blame.  They desire to keep you under their false power through condemnation, pressure and shame.

This is not the wisdom that comes down from above.
Instead, it is from the earth, natural and demonic.
Wherever there is jealousy and selfish ambition,
there is disorder and everything that is evil.
– James 3:14-16 (Common English Bible)

You are isolated from those who truly love and care for you, especially your Heavenly Father.  Their mission is to gain power over your emotions and cause you to feel utterly alone.  They demand to be your only source of validation. This is done through gaslighting, exploitation and an assortment of words to destroy your self-confidence and self-worth.  Their counsel sounds like “enlightenment”, nonetheless, they impose a legalistic standard on you that can never be fulfilled and to which they themselves do not adhere.  They are inconsiderate of your dreams and use your talents for their selfish gain. You begin to question your purpose and feel hopeless.  You avoid fellowship with those you once considered family.  You desperately search for yourself while entangled in their web of manipulation, lies and deception to no avail.

Regardless of the abuse tactic, there is good news:

You can upgrade your life today.  You will never need anyone’s permission to improve your own wellbeing.  Just because they may disapprove or speak something negative over you, it does not mean you have to receive or believe it.  You are no longer subject to the abusive power or harassment of fake Christians.  No longer allow them direct access to your ears for any extended period of time. If you must interact with them on a regular basis, guard your heart from their wicked words.  Replace their words with the promises found in Scriptures.  There is power for the brokenhearted.  Find refuge in the Word and discover the power of God within you!

Behold, I give unto you power to tread on serpents and scorpions,
and over all the power of the enemy:
and nothing shall by any means hurt you. – Luke 10:19

Peace, health and happiness belong to you.  You are a beloved child of God!  He desires the very best for you.  Renew your personal relationship and spend time with Him through prayer.  Give yourself a daily dose of grace and power to fuel your life-changing, transformation process.  Remember, God will supply a way out of any situation that you will be able to endure.  This process will strengthen you, fill you with compassion and prepare you for good success.  It is never too late to start a new journey with your Heavenly Father!

But the wisdom that is from above is first pure, then peaceable, gentle,
and easy to be entreated, full of mercy and good fruits,
without partiality, and without hypocrisy.
And the fruit of righteousness is sown in peace
of them that make peace.  – James 3:17-18

What are you most afraid of?  What fear goes beyond the temporary shock of something like a snake, clown or spider? This month, let’s attack the “scary things” that have tried to debilitate progress and become permanent in our lives.  With the power of God, now is the time to conquer our deepest, darkest fears!

For God hath not given us the spirit of fear; but of power,
and of love, and of a sound mind. – 2 Timothy 1:7

Here are some of the fears many of us encounter:

  • Running out of money, resources, or food
  • Making a wrong decision with family or business
  • Fear of failure and the shame or judgement that results
  • Generational curses or demonic influence
  • Rejection in relationships or career path
  • Getting sick or dying from disease
  • Losing control and becoming stressed or depressed

When waging a spiritual assault against fear, you need to know what God’s Word says about overcoming it. This is a serious war – fear wants to control, torment and keep you in bondage. Unforgiveness, jealousy, bitterness and anger are all some of the tactics fear will use to oppress you.  Meditating on God’s Word and hearing the good news of Jesus Christ weakens the grip of fear over your life.  Instead of fear causing anxiety and making you afraid to live victoriously, you can confront it with the powerful promises of God!

There are so many, but here are two scriptures you can store in your arsenal…

Fear thou not; for I am with thee:
be not dismayed; for I am thy God:
I will strengthen thee; yea, I will help thee;
yea, I will uphold thee with the right hand
of my righteousness. – Isaiah 41:10

In all thy ways acknowledge him,
and he shall direct thy paths. – Proverbs 3:6

Friend, God loves you and wants you to be free. Let Him show you how to live a fearless, blessed life. Seek Him and unleash the supernatural power residing in you. Today is a perfect time to begin a new relationship with your Heavenly Father and…Live Fearless!
